{"product_id":"330907-05-30-10-02-00-bently-nevada-proximity-probes-3300-nsv-series","title":"330907-05-30-10-02-00 Bently Nevada Proximity Probes 3300 NSv Series","description":"\u003ch3\u003eProduct Overview\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e Bently Nevada 330907-05-30-10-02-00 is a specialized 3300 NSv (Near-field) Reverse Mount Proximity Probe engineered for high-precision measurement in space-constrained rotating machinery. As a key component of the 3300 XL 8 mm transducer family, this probe provides non-contact measurement of shaft vibration and position. The NSv technology platform is uniquely calibrated to handle applications where the target surface area is smaller or the required measurement gap is narrower than what traditional 3300 XL probes can accurately capture.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This probe leverages advanced eddy-current sensing to track shaft dynamics in real-time, delivering data that is fundamental to the operation of Turbomachinery Supervisory Instrumentation (TSI) systems. Its reverse-mount configuration is particularly advantageous for machines where external access to the probe housing is limited, allowing for internal mounting while maintaining accessibility for cabling and adjustment.
